Ooh, this is good. More than, in fact. "Bandages" by Hot
Hot Heat, instant addiction!
This urgent rock'n'roll treat of a single is released on March 24th
with extra songs "Apt.101" and "Move
On". Hot Hot Heat? Neat Neat Neat! Steve Bays
(Vocals, Keyboards), Dante DeCaro (Guitar), Paul Hawley (Drums)
Dustin Hawthorne (Bass) - on the strength of their CD I am convinced that
I must see them live. Well, waddya know, I can! The Barfly (Glasgow
25th, Liverpool 26th, London 27th, Cardiff 29th, Bristol Louisiana - 28th and on May
2nd @ London ULU). Recent shows over the pond ended with stage
invasions - that's pretty honest audience feedback. "Bandages" will be followed by an album 'Make Up The Breakdown' on
March 31st (releases: Sub Pop/B-Unique Records)
They have the tunes, the gigs and the exposure - watch them go! Blame Canada! |

| Feeder were among the many bands missing nominations at The Brits but,
believably, their career, which has risen steadily from day one, continues rising to the
point where ignoring them is not an option. "Just The Way I'm Feeling" was
a Top 10 single in January and "Comfort In Sound", which went
gold week of release is an album that has just taken on legs of it's own, and run for the
stars... Feeder have always worked hard internationally, and following
pleasing 60,000 adoring fans on their own massive sellout headline tour of LaLaLand, they
will play Osaka, Nagoya and Tokyo before supporting Coldplay's European and UK tour of
megadomes throughout March and April. www.Feederweb.com

MOVING UNITS formed in the 21st century. They met
thru music and DJd together at clubs n parties then gigged around the West Coast of
America and began claiming a fan base who they are playing for now before heading to
LaLaLand with Hot Hot Heat. Moving Units EP is released 31st March 2003 - RX
Records |
